Output ddfa2b671888614b9a8dbffdc72048fd92c6bfe988ba72a870b1349cdb79f17e:59
- value
- 683889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 881064f1c9b12cf26148c0323a80f7b30064c673 OP_EQUAL
- address
- 3E6TTjGi8kDLoKhP9CCAKVdbCzTgppPL1y
- transaction
- ddfa2b671888614b9a8dbffdc72048fd92c6bfe988ba72a870b1349cdb79f17e